Title | Goodbye, Mother Machree |
Composer | Ball, Ernest R. |
Lyricist | Brennan, J. Keirn |
Publisher | M. Witmark & Sons |
Place of Publication | New York (N.Y.) |
Year of Publication | 1918 |
Date of Copyright | 1918-05-31 |
Lyrics | Goodbye, Mother Machree Verse: Now the time has come to leave, mother mine, You must promise not to grieve, mother mine, On the day the war is through I’ll come sailing back to you, Back to where the home lights shine. Refrain: Goodbye, mother machree, dry your tears and keep on smiling. Now don’t you fear, I’ll soon be here, for your love will guide me, dear, Keep the homefires burning, the latch string out for me, When the clouds roll by, to your arms I’ll fly, goodbye, mother machree. Verse: On the road to victory “over there,” All your love will follow me ev’rywhere, You will watch for me I know, there beside the firelight glow, Waiting in the old arm chair. Refrain |
